Transaction 376e98873ed507628cbe103827ba4d586e4225071135d624da2d256c45a22493
1 Input
1 Output
-
376e98873ed507628cbe103827ba4d586e4225071135d624da2d256c45a22493:0
- value
- 1725049334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f87098deb430955a4d97affa8dec5b15877687e OP_EQUAL
- address
- MJ4s1HFRsBNeUFqYRn9DTHXcYX83U6W5MP